To Create or Modify Text Styles
- Click Home tab Annotation panel Text Style. Find.
- In the Text Style dialog box, do one of the following: To create a style, click New and enter the style name.
- Font.
- Size.
- Oblique angle.
- Character spacing.
- Annotative.
- Specify other settings as needed.

Can you change font in AutoCAD?
Font. Under Font Name, select the font you want to use.To assign an Asian-language font, select the name of an SHX font file, check Use Big Font, and select an Asian-language big font.

What is a text style in AutoCAD?
A text style is a named collection of text settings that controls the appearance of text, such as font, line spacing, justification, and color. You create text styles to specify the format of text quickly, and to ensure that text conforms to industry or project standards.

How do I change mtext to text in AutoCAD?
In order to convert Mtext to Text you can use explode command. Select Mtext then type X on the command line and press enter to convert Mtext to text.

How do I edit words in AutoCAD?
After you create a multiline text object in AutoCAD, you can edit it in the same way as a single-line text object: Select the object, right-click, and choose Mtext Edit or Properties. Mtext Edit: Selecting this option opens the In-Place Text Editor window so that you can change the text contents and formatting.

How many text styles do you need in AutoCAD?
In the Style section of the Style panel, the defined text styles can be selected. AutoCAD by default has two styles, Annotative and Standard. The Annotative button turns Annotation Scale on or off for the selected text but doesn’t change the text style.

What is the difference between text and mtext?
Text is single lined. For a simple call out, like “Outlet”. Mtext is a multi-line text tool.
How do I fix text in AutoCAD?
Clear and reapply the formatting to any malfunctioning MTEXT (Multiline text) objects.
- Select the malfunctioning object.
- Right-click and choose Mtext Edit.
- Right-click the text and choose Select all.
- Right-click the text and choose Remove formatting > Remove all formatting.
- Reapply formatting as needed.
What is Mtext command in AutoCAD?
You can create several paragraphs of text as a single multiline text (mtext) object. With the built-in editor, you can format the text appearance, columns, and boundaries. After you specify the point for the opposite corner when the ribbon is active, the Text Editor ribbon contextual tab displays.
